Chattanooga strike team deployed to assist Hickman County with winter storm recovery
Chattanooga, TN – A strike team from Hamilton County and the City of Chattanooga was deployed Sunday to Hickman County to assist with winter storm recovery efforts, according to the Chattanooga Fire Department.
The team departed from the Chattanooga Fire Training Center for a one-week deployment after a request was made by the Hamilton County Office of Emergency Management on behalf of the Tennessee Emergency Management Agency.
Personnel and equipment from Chattanooga Fire, Chattanooga Public Works, and Hamilton County OEM were sent to support recovery operations and relieve local crews who have been working extended hours under strenuous conditions.
Officials said the team will assist communities as they continue efforts to restore services and recover from storm impacts.
